Challenges in Energy & Utilities
FORECASTING ACCURACY
Traditional demand forecasting methods struggle with renewable intermittency, extreme weather impacts, and rapidly changing load patterns from electrification and AI data centers.
NERC CIP COMPLIANCE
Critical Infrastructure Protection standards require sophisticated cybersecurity controls while maintaining operational efficiency and real-time system visibility.
GRID RESILIENCE
Climate change increases extreme weather frequency while distributed energy resources create complex operational challenges requiring new planning approaches.
CYBER SECURITY
Energy systems face increasing nation-state attacks and ransomware threats that could cause widespread blackouts if not properly defended.
REGULATORY EVOLUTION
2025 NERC CIP updates expand coverage to previously low-impact assets while introducing new extreme weather planning requirements under TPL-008-1.
